1 review for Ben L Smith High School

  • Reviewed by Former Student on May 14, 2009
  • Rating: 3 (3 / 5) Flag as inappropriate
  • Ben L Smith High, has had some rough times but is improving. The teachers really care and if you show even the smallest interest in your future or you have potential they try to motivate and inspire you to the fullest, regardless of you ethnicity latino, black, white or asian. The teachers recommend you for all types of programs that they think will help to develop your leadership skills. I have great respect for the teachers at Smith High, because they take on challenges many could not. They have a high male teacher ratio which is good for the male role model issues, many of the disciplinary issues the school faces are typically with the males. They added some new curriculum choices for the kids which has really taken off and the kids seem to be increasing in their awareness of their future. I was a student here before moving to a different high school my junior year and if the teachers could have just followed me to my new school just the expectation of greatness they have of you makes you want to try harder and do better. I currently attend Southern Guilford and the teachers are horrible here!
